Meet Homer Simpson

• Homer’s neighbour’s name is Ned Flanders.

• Ned is going to

Florida for a week, and he has hired Homer to water his plants.

Page 3: Relating Number Sequences to Graphs

The Options

• Homer has a choice. He can:– Receive $10 each day for

payment, OR

– Receive $5 on the first day, $10 on the second day, $15 on the third day, and so on.

Which option will give Homer the greatest total earnings?

Page 4: Relating Number Sequences to Graphs

Comparing the Options

•Let’s use tables to compare the two options:–OPTION 1: $10 each day

Day Number

Payment on This Day

Total Earnings

1 $10 $10

2 $10 $20

3 $10 $30

• Can you describe the pattern using words or an algebraic expression?

Page 5: Relating Number Sequences to Graphs

Comparing the Options

–OPTION 2: $5 on the 1st day, $10 on the 2nd day, $15 on the 3rd day, and so on.

Day Number

Payment on This Day

Total Earnings

1 $5 $5

2 $10 $15

3 $15 $30

• Can you describe the pattern using words or an algebraic expression?
